Van Nistelrooy hails ‘incredible’ Amad Diallo after PAOK double seals Man United’s first Europa League win

Manchester United interim manager Ruud Van Nistelrooy sang Amad Diallo’s praises after the winger’s double helped the Red Devils earn their first win in this season’s Europa League, Soccernet.football reports.

Diallo, who had not started for United since October 3, seized his chance by scoring twice in the second half to secure a 2-0 victory over PAOK in front of a bubbling Old Trafford.

The two goals marked the Ivorian’s first brace for United, with five of his six goals for the club across all competitions scored at Old Trafford.

Interim manager Van Nistelrooy waxed lyrical in Amad’s praise following the full-time whistle. He praised the winger’s incredible attitude despite his lack of playing time.

“I think Amad made a difference for us today obviously, because of his goals, but he was sharp,” Van Nistelrooy told TNT Sports.

“I think in the first half he was also one of the few who was at his level. So well done to him, good game.

“He’s been incredible (in training) actually, every time he was never affected by not playing, always training, always staying on the pitch, always saying ‘Ruud let’s do more’.”

For his second goal on of the, the 22-year-old Ivorian created his own luck. He won the ball back deep in PAOK territory, drove forward, and bent a lovely 20-yard effort into the left-hand side of the goal.

“He made his own goal. Coming inside with the left, getting inside the far post was excellent,” Van Nistelrooy added.

“But I think this is what made the goal, he won his own duel and then took the shot for the goal.”

Van Nistelrooy is set to oversee his last game in charge of United on Sunday, November 10 against Leicester City in the Premier League. Ruben Amorim will then come onboard as permanent head coach from November 11.
